NHL suspends Canucks' Carson Soucy for shot to Connor McDavid - ESPN

Vancouver defenseman Carson Soucy has been suspended one game for cross-checking Edmonton forward Connor McDavid in the face during Game 3 of their second-round Stanley Cup playoff series on Sunday.

"We Are In Last Stages Of Intense Training Block": Harmanpreet Singh Ahead Of Paris Olympics

As 75 days are left for the commencement of the Paris 2024 Olympics where the Indian men's Hockey team will take the field at the Yves-du-Manior Stadium in quest to end 44-year gold medal drought, skipper Harmanpreet Singh has said the team entered "last stages of an intense training block" in their preparation for the marque event. India have to overcome the reigning Olympic Champions Belgium (World No. 2), Australia (World No. 3), Argentina (World No. 7), New Zealand (World No. 10), and Ireland (World No. 11) in Pool B to secure a top-four finish in the pool to progress to the quarterfinals.

Bedard scores another pair to lead Canada to win over Denmark at hockey world championships

Connor Bedard scored twice again and added an assist as Canada eased past Denmark 5-1 Sunday for its second straight victory at the ice hockey world championship.
